Hey everyone,

Sorry for not updating in a while. It’s just been a very busy month for me. I did want to at least post my results from the 5k Turkey Trot I did on Thursday. I finished in 55:30 which gave me an average pace of 17:52. It wasn’t a PR, but I was pleased with my time since it was my first organized race since my spinal surgery 7 1/2 months ago.

Here were my split times:

Mile 1 – 16:55
Mile 2 – 18:12
Mile 3 – 18:41
Last .1 – 1:41

Ho Ho Ho Happy Dance

I finished another piece a couple of days ago. This is the 2007 limited edition Christmas kit from Lizzie Kate. It was a really fun and fairly quick stitch. I think I’m going to finish it into either a pillow or I may take a shot at making it into a flat fold. I’ve never done the flat fold finishing technique, so it would be something new for me.

ho ho ho

Designer: Lizzie Kate
Fabric: Light mocha cashel linen
Fibers: Crescent Colors cotton floss & DMC cotton floss
Extras: Kreinik 032 blending filament for snow (not called for in the kit)

I’ve also joined a SAL on one of my Yahoo groups. We’re all working on Gingerbread Cottage by Country Cottage Needleworks. It’s a really cute piece and I’m hoping to get it done in time to finish it as a pillow for Christmas. Here’s my first progress photo taken yesterday at the end of my first day of stitching on it:

gingerbread cottage

Designer: Country Cottage Needleworks
Fabric: Unknown hand-dyed linen from a grab bag of fabric
Fibers: Crescent Colors cotton floss and DMC cotton floss
